You could use a white board of some sort as a bounce board, reflecting whatever available light you have. This technique is far cheaper than buying a second light and if used correctly can give a very similar effect. Also you could just buy a cheap can light from home depot as your primary light source.

I doubt a zoom shot is more common than a Wide Shot, MCU, BCU or a jib/crane shot. Also, 1:54 - Definitely not what I'd call a long-shot. It's way to far, high up and wide to be considered an LS. This list has most definitions correct but it's far from accurate. You could've also used better and more examples. I.e. The establishing shot you used was good but it might confuse people... it doesn't necessarily have to be moving, it can be a just a really wide shot of the setting.
